On October 18, Curry accepted an interview with NBA reporter Mark Medina and talked about his training plan. He hopes that through this plan, he can ensure that he can maintain the top competitive level in the 2025-26 season, and may even play until the age of 40.
"I can only say that I hope I can have the choice, and the premise is that my ability can really support me to continue playing," Curry said, "I'm not sure whether (playing until the age of 40) is appropriate. I'm not sure if I still want to play at that time. Various situations are possible. But it is very important to me if I can make my own decision instead of being forced to accept the decision made by others. "
Curry has enough time to plan for the future. His contract with the Warriors will last until the 2026-27 season, and both parties have stated many times over the years that "Curry will play for the Warriors throughout his NBA career" as a priority goal for both parties.
In the short term, Curry can clearly understand his status in the 2025-26 season: whether he can maintain an All-Star level of competition and whether he can maintain his health. Last season, Curry delivered an outstanding performance in 70 regular season games: averaging 24.5 points, shooting 44.8% from the field, 39.7% from the three-point range, and providing 6.0 assists. After acquiring Butler from the Heat before the trade deadline, the Warriors entered the playoffs through the play-in rounds as the seventh seed in the Western Conference. And in games where Curry and Butler played together, the Warriors achieved a record of 27 wins and 8 losses - a performance that made the team full of expectations for the prospect of "the two working together for a full season."
Although Curry averaged 22.6 points per game in 5 playoff games, shot 47.7% from the field, 40% from three-point range, and sent out 5.1 assists, he still felt the ruthlessness of "Father Time". In the seven-game series against the Rockets in the first round, he persisted in fighting against the opponent's high-intensity defense; however, in the first game of the Western Conference semifinals against the Timberwolves, Curry only played 13 minutes and scored 13 points. He left the game with 8 minutes and 19 seconds left in the second quarter due to a Grade 1 strain of his left hamstring. He subsequently missed the Warriors' remaining four playoff games.
Curry's trainer Payne recently revealed that Curry spent a lot of time in strength training during the offseason and improved his decision-making speed - the purpose is to maximize health protection, offset the possible decline in athletic ability in advance, and at the same time, when Butler assumes organizational responsibilities, he can better function on the off-ball end.
How to extend your career for a longer period of time? Curry mentioned four key factors -
"First of all, rest is critical. Sleep is the simplest and most important answer. Honestly, maintaining mental health is also critical, to be in the right state of mind - especially in this day and age, whether in the season or offseason, There's so much noise and distraction around me. It doesn't mean I need to spend a lot of extra time on the court, but it's about having a clear purpose and intention every minute. So it's about sleeping, breathing, practicing hard, and taking a break from basketball when I need to."
